My Golden1 Credit Union CLI Experience

Hi Everyone,

 

I wanted to share my CLI request experience with the Golden1 Credit Union (CU), as I have noticed there are not many posts about them. To give some background, I have been a member of Golden1 for the last 4 years with a premium checking account and the Platinum Rewards credit card. When I originally applied for the card 2 years ago I had a 650 Fico 8 score and was approved for a SL of $3,000.

 

The application process for a CLI requires a hard pull of your Experian data. Considering I'm actively working on building my relationship with them, I decided to take the dive and allow them to pull my credit as I am currently at a 715 Fico 8 score. The application process can be done either online or in branch, though I chose to complete everything online. After submitting my application online, I was asked to go into a branch to verify my identity (I've previously had my indentity stolen, so I have a "hold" on my account that requires me to verify in person I am taking out any new loans or products) - so this step wont apply to most. After verifying my identity, the funding department began processing my request. The following day I received an update on my online application (shown below) that my application had been denied due to "Failing to meet the minimum credit score, and Excessive obligations in relation to income."  I recently paid off all of my credit cards and two loans, so my revolving outstanding balances are $0, with an available credit of over $10,000 between all my accounts.

 

I am now on the line with the lending team to see if I can get some more detailed information on their decision, and hopefully convince them to reconsider the application. More details to follow.

Thanks everyone for all your positive notes, I appreciate it.

 

Firstly, Golden1's lending team can be reached directly at 1-800-849-2579. After spending the last 30 or so minutes working with underwriting, I was informed that the credit union now uses the Fico 2 version, which showed my score being signficantly lower (657) than my Fico 8 of 715. Additionally, I was told that my high balances on loans were also what was affecting my approval, which included a previous loan that I had for about a year to consolidate accounts (paid off as of January of this year) and my student loans which are currently deferred. They asked if I was able to prove that my last major loan was paid in full, as well as that my student loans were actually in deferrment, which I did via their secured email. After going back to the underwriter, I was ultimately declined my CLI request due to my score being under their minimum threshold of 670 (F2) to qualify. 

 

I'll admit, I am a little disappointed and irritated, as I wouldn't have applied for the increase at all had I known that they were now using Fico2. Alas, that's part of the game - better luck next time (if there even is one).
